Blessed Are
The Meek
Shelly went to her class.
In her class was a friend that lived on her same street.
"Hi, Katie." Shelly was glad to see a friend
"Hi Shelly. If you need any help, just let me know," said Katie with a smile
"Thank you Katie," said Shelly.
Mrs. Nelson, their teacher, announced Katie got the highest grade in the class from their test last week in social studies.
Mrs. Nelson gave Katie a treat.
The whole class clapped for Katie.
"Congratulations, Katie," Shelly said.
"Thank you. During recess, we can share this treat," Katie offered
"No, Katie, its yours, you earned it," said Shelly
With a smile Katie answered, "I want to share with you."
"Thank you Katie, and I could use some help in social studies."
"Sure Shelly, right after school."
Jesus teaches us that we all have gifts that He has given to us. We should share what we are good at with others and never be boastful.Wasn't that nice of Katie?
